863 metric tons of potatoes produced in Tanahu



TANAHU: A total of 863 metric tons of potatoes have been produced in Tanahun under the Potato Promotion Project Program. In the fiscal year 2024/25, as many as 13 farmer groups cultivated potatoes on 1,000 ropanis of land.

Gopal Sharma Lamichhane, Chief of the Agriculture Knowledge Center, stated that potato farming was carried out in clusters through farmer groups and cooperatives, with each cluster covering at least 30 ropanis.

A budget of Rs 9.33 million was allocated for the program, and each group was provided with 80 quintals of seed potatoes.

According to Lamichhane, Janakdev, MS, and Cardinal varieties were distributed to farmers at a 75 percent subsidy. In addition to seeds, various farming equipment was also provided to support cultivation.
